Solution for 6-18=-3z equation:


Simplifying
6 + -18 = -3z

Combine like terms: 6 + -18 = -12
-12 = -3z

Solving
-12 = -3z

Solving for variable 'z'.

Move all terms containing z to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'3z' to each side of the equation.
-12 + 3z = -3z + 3z

Combine like terms: -3z + 3z = 0
-12 + 3z = 0

Add '12' to each side of the equation.
-12 + 12 + 3z = 0 + 12

Combine like terms: -12 + 12 = 0
0 + 3z = 0 + 12
3z = 0 + 12

Combine like terms: 0 + 12 = 12
3z = 12

Divide each side by '3'.
z = 4

Simplifying
z = 4
